The Striding Dales' presents the natural beauty of the Yorkshire dales by describing the local culture, music, people, and charming villages and scenery. Including chapters on the Bolton Priory, Knaresborough, Percival Hall, Threshfield, Thorpe-in-the-Hollow, and more. A splendid book, beautifully written. A must for anyone interested in Dales history. Full of anecdotes on dales people and events in the mid-1900s. Contains seventy four line illustrations and a full colour frontipiece. Ref KKK 3. A.
